Paradip Green Hydrogen Jetty to Boost Odisha's Maritime Economy: CM Majhi
•
Odisha CM Mohan Charan Majhi announced the Centre's approval for a Rs 797-crore green hydrogen jetty at Paradip Port.
•
The project, with a 4 MTPA capacity, will connect Odisha's green hydrogen production clusters to global markets.
•
It aims to strengthen clean energy export logistics and advance India’s National Green Hydrogen Mission.
•
The initiative is expected to accelerate green investments, generate employment, and reinforce Odisha’s maritime economy.
•
The Paradip Port Authority will implement the project on a build-operate-transfer (BOT) basis, with completion expected within 24 months.
